码迷,mamicode.com
首页 >  
搜索关键字:控制反转    ( 1582个结果
简单的Spring IoC入门学习
IoC控制反转,由spring统一管理类的创建,不再由自己创建。 一、导入所需jar core、context、beans、expression、common-logging 二、目标类 package com.claudxyz.IoC; public interface UserService { ...
分类:编程语言   时间:2020-01-24 17:13:23    阅读次数:86
Spring常见面试题
1. 什么是SpringIOCSpringIOC指的是控制反转,应用程序对象的创建,配置,维护,依赖交给了SpringIOC容器统一进行管理,从而实现松耦合。 2. 说一下SpringIOC的实现原理使用反射机制+xml技术 3. 什么是SpringAOPAOP,即面向切面编程。作为OOP的一种补充 ...
分类:编程语言   时间:2020-01-21 20:00:03    阅读次数:69
通过配置文件,反射,工厂模式实现IOC控制反转
package designMode; import java.io.File;import java.io.FileInputStream;import java.io.FileNotFoundException;import java.io.FileOutputStream;import jav ...
分类:其他好文   时间:2020-01-17 20:43:54    阅读次数:74
spring入门篇2 --- IOC设计思想
在上一篇中已经大致了解了IOC的设计思想,IOC全拼是Inversion of Control,就是控制反转,以前我们都是自己创建对象,进行实例化,现在交给框架spring来进行控制,以实现高度的解耦。 IOC是设计思想,是Spring的核心,我们必须要掌握,因此通过几个例子,来看看到底是如何实现的 ...
分类:编程语言   时间:2020-01-13 22:05:46    阅读次数:85
Spring源码解析
Spring源码解析 IOC (Inversion of Control):控制反转 1. ioc是一个容器,帮我们管理所有组件 2. 依赖注入(DI):@Autowired:自动赋值 3. 某个组件要使用Spring提供的更多(IOC,AOP),==必须注册到容器中。== IOC源码核心 1)、C ...
分类:编程语言   时间:2020-01-12 22:08:13    阅读次数:94
Spring学习记录1——IoC容器
IoC容器 1.1 IoC概述 Ioc(Inverse of Control,控制反转)是Spring容器的内核。对于软件来说,即某一接口具体实现类的选择控制权从调用类中移除,转交给第三方决定,即由Spring容器借由Bean配置来进行控制。也被称作DI(Dependency Injection,依 ...
分类:编程语言   时间:2020-01-11 22:17:31    阅读次数:95
对spring IOC容器、DI的理解
1.IOC是什么? IOC(控制反转)是一种管理bean的容器,它的本质是对象工厂(接口)。 在应用程序中的组件需要获取资源时,传统的方式是组件主动从容器中获取所需的资源,在这种模式下,开发人员需要知道具体容器中资源的获取方式,增加了学习成本,降低了开发效率。 反转控制思想改由容器主动将资源推送给需 ...
分类:编程语言   时间:2020-01-11 00:33:27    阅读次数:93
Java:控制反转(IoC)与依赖注入(DI)
01、紧耦合 在我们编码的过程中,通常都需要两个或者更多的类通过彼此的合作来实现业务逻辑,也就是说,某个对象需要获取与其合作对象的引用,如果这个获取的过程需要自己实现,代码的耦合度就会高,维护起来的成本就比较高。 我们来通过实战模拟一下。假如老王是少林寺的主持,他想让小二和尚去扫达摩院的地,代码可以 ...
分类:编程语言   时间:2020-01-10 22:03:35    阅读次数:72
详解Spring IoC容器
一、Spring IoC容器概述 1.依赖反转(依赖注入):依赖对象的获得被反转了。 如果合作对象的引用或依赖关系的管理由具体对象来完成,会导致代码的高度耦合和可测试性的降低,这对复杂的面向对象系统的设计是非常不利的。 在Spring中,IoC容器是实现依赖控制反转这个模式的载体,它可以在对象生成或 ...
分类:编程语言   时间:2020-01-09 22:25:13    阅读次数:74
IoC控制反转
IoC控制反转:实现了程序之间的解耦合,简化开发。思想:在Spring框架中,所有对象的生命周期和对象之间的关系都由Spring来管理,不用程序员进行操心。只需要在使用的时候,从Spring容器中取出来用就行。对象创建:1.通过在配置文件中使用<bean>标签来创建。可以使用无参构造方法,也可以使用 ...
分类:其他好文   时间:2020-01-08 12:52:16    阅读次数:66
1582条   上一页 1 ... 14 15 16 17 18 ... 159 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!